§ 32-21-7-2 — Property owned by state or political subdivision; adverse possession action against political subdivision barred after 6-30-1998

Text
(a)Title to real property owned by the state or
a political subdivision (as defined in IC 36-1-2-13) may not be
alienated by adverse possession.
(b)A cause of action based on adverse possession may not be
commenced against a political subdivision (as defined in IC 36-1-2-13)
after June 30, 1998.
[Pre-2002 Recodification Citation: 32-1-20-2.]

Legislative History
As added by P.L.2-2002, SEC.6. Amended by P.L.16-2009,
SEC.30.
